Telework to save California $225 million during gasoline price crisis

The Issue
The world's oil supply is burning. Shipping routes are closed. Gas prices are climbing and there's no end in sight.
Government workers of California proved they can effectively telework. They did so in 2020 with no warning and no preparation. Now they have a tested, stable I.T. environment to do so again. Shouldn't we send them home once more as fuel prices rise and families struggle to make ends meet?
Additionally, the state should be conserving oil for emergency services, food transport, and critical infrastructure. Proactive decisions are better than reactive ones as national and global instability carries us to destinations unknown.
Governor Gavin Newsom: Order your State employees to return to 100% telework. It's one concrete action you can take right now to ease the collective burden, and a signal to the rest of the country about what forward-thinking governance looks like.
